Online Sales Manager

Garden's Need Pvt. Ltd

Posted on: 19 Mar 2024

Job Location: Delhi, IN

Job Description:

Similar jobs

Online Sales Manager

Online Sales Manager

Delhi, IN

19 Mar 2024

Online Sales Manager

Online Sales Manager

Delhi, IN

19 Mar 2024

Online Sales Manager

Online Sales Manager

Delhi, IN

19 Mar 2024

Online Sales Manager

Online Sales Manager

Delhi, IN

19 Mar 2024